UCL (University College London) offers Finance MSc as a 1-year postgraduate Masters Degree (Taught) programme in Banking and Finance. Based in London, the programme is delivered by the university's specialist faculty and welcomes international applicants from across Africa and beyond.
Tuition is £48,250 per year. English-language entry requires IELTS 7 overall or TOEFL iBT 96. Intakes run across 2 windows (Term 1 (September), 2026 and Term 1 (September), 2027).

Entry requirements
A minimum of an upper-second class Bachelor's degree from a UK university or an overseas qualification of an equivalent standard in one of the following subjects: economics, finance, mathematics, accounting, engineering, statistics or any combination thereof. Degrees from other disciplines may be considered if the applicant can demonstrate sufficient quantitative skills. GMAT/GRE are not required for the MSc Finance programme, however, strong GRE quantitative (162+) or overall GMAT or GMAT Focus (at least 80th percentile) scores will add weight to an application.
